What Is a Pell Grant and How Does It Help Esthetician Students?
A Pell Grant is a form of federal financial aid awarded to undergraduate students who demonstrate financial need. Unlike loans, Pell Grants do not need to be repaid. These grants can be used for:
Tuition and fees
Books and supplies
Equipment or kit costs
Living expenses
To qualify, you must fill out the Free Application for Federal Student Aid (FAFSA) and enroll in a Pell Grant-approved school with an eligible esthetician program.

Career-Ready Curriculum
Each program includes core esthetics topics such as:
Skin analysis and consultation
Cleansing, exfoliation, and extractions
Product knowledge and retailing
Facial machines and electrotherapy
Waxing, brow shaping, and lash tinting
Safety, sanitation, and Florida licensing laws
How to Apply for Pell Grants in Orlando Esthetician Schools
Fill out the FAFSA at https://studentaid.gov – use the school’s federal code.
Check eligibility based on income, citizenship, and enrollment status.
Meet with the school’s financial aid office for help with paperwork and award letters.
Apply to the esthetician program and provide your FAFSA documentation.
Start training toward becoming a licensed esthetician in Florida.
